Choosing the Perfect Office Desk: A Comprehensive Guide


If you spend most of your day working from an office, you know that having a comfortable workspace can make a significant difference in your productivity level. An important element of your office setup is your desk, which can impact your posture, organization, and workflow. With so many different desks available on the market, choosing the right one can be overwhelming. In this comprehensive guide, we’ll go over the essential factors to consider when selecting the perfect office desk for your space.


1. Determine Your Desk’s Purpose


Before buying a desk, it’s important to identify your primary use for this piece of furniture. Do you simply need a basic surface for your laptop, or do you need a desk that can accommodate multiple monitors? Will you be using it to store important documents and files? Will you be meeting with clients at your desk? The answers to these questions will help you determine the size, shape, and style of your desk.


2. Consider the Size and Shape of Your Space


Another critical factor to consider is the size and shape of your workspace. If you’re working from a small home office, you may have limited desk space available, whereas in a larger commercial office, you may have the luxury of choosing a bigger desk. Additionally, consider the physical shape of your room. If you have an L-shaped office, a corner desk may be the perfect fit, while a simple rectangular desk may work better in a square office space.


3. Think About Your Storage Needs


If you work from an office, chances are you’ll need some storage space to keep your paperwork, files, and other office supplies. Consider the storage options that your desk provides. Some desks come with built-in drawers and storage compartments, while others allow you to add your storage solutions. If storage space is a top priority for you, consider purchasing a desk with plenty of integrated storage options.


4. Assess the Desk’s Material and Durability


Your desk is an investment that should last for several years. As such, you want to choose one that is made of high-quality and durable materials. The most common materials used in office desks are wood, metal, and glass. Depending on your preferences, you can go for a traditional wood desk, a sleek metal design, or a modern glass workspace. When assessing the material, consider not only the desk’s durability but also its maintenance requirements.


5. Determine Your Budget


Office desks can range from a few hundred to several thousand dollars. While you want to purchase a desk that fulfills your needs, you also need to establish a budget for your purchase. Choosing a desk that exceeds your budget could compromise other essential office pieces such as your chair, lighting, or computer peripherals. Assess your budget and prioritize what’s necessary for your professional demands.


6. Check the Desk’s Configuration


You also want to assess the desk’s configuration, which refers to the desk’s orientation and its clearance. Some offices require desks with enough legroom, allowing you to move around freely. If you’re someone who works with a lot of cables and cords, a desk configured with cable management systems may come in handy. Desks with adjustable height features are also essential if you require a change in position during work hours.


7. Think About Ergonomics


An ergonomic workspace can improve your comfort and productivity levels, reducing tiredness and preventing aches and pains. Choosing the right desk can positively affect your posture and alleviate muscle stiffness, so it’s worth taking the time to find an ergonomic option that fits your needs. Look for adjustable options that offer customizable features from height, tilt, to swivel while also keeping in mind your body measures.


Conclusion


Choosing the perfect office desk for your workspace can be challenging. However, with the right considerations, you can improve your comfort, productivity, and overall workspace organization. Assessing your budget, workspace requirements, and storage needs, among other factors, can help you select the perfect office desk for your professional demands. Remember that the ultimate goal should be to choose a desk that provides comfort and reduces the risk of injury.
